Anyone have a RZR XP 4 1000 EPS?

If you do I was hoping to get the length from the rear bumper to the front of the front tire. On the website it gives a length of 146" but that is bumper to bumper. I have 144" from my back door to the kitchen cabinets so that is why Im looking for the measurements from back to front tire. I would do it myself if there was a dealership closer that 2 hours from me. Thanks!

  • I'm sure you can make it fit. I have a Maverick Max that I fit into my Voltage 3950 with a 12' garage and the Max is 1-2 inches longer than the RZR. I do have to take the front bumper off to make it fit, but it's only about 5 minutes to take on and off. The RZR doesn't come with any bumpers and you won't be able to travel with any but you could easily do the same.

  • I ran into the same issue with the Can-am Maverick 1000XRS I just purchased. My garage in my TH is 118" and the Mav measured by the book 118.8". I had to let the air out of the tires a little so it would fit height wise but it just barely fit. Now just to be safe I remove the front bumper and that clears up 6 extra inches of space to play with. At 146" & 144" I think you'll be fine. Letting air out of the tires will help some and if the bumper is removable like mine then removal of that may be an option for you also.
